It is perhaps ironic that Johnson, who is often credited with being the "first writer in English to depend truly on the literary marketplace," actually "depended heavily on a royal pension that rewarded him for some political work - work sinister enough to place Johnson's name not on the civil list but on the crown's secret service list" (Wilson, p. 99).
